Sugar Skull Coloring Pages for Cinco de Mayo and Dia de los Muertos - 50 Unique Designs

Celebrate Cinco de Mayo and honor Dia de los Muertos with our vibrant collection of 50 unique sugar skull coloring pages. Each page is thoughtfully designed to engage and inspire creativity in students. These illustrations, featuring intricate patterns and cultural symbols, are perfect for teaching about these significant holidays and the rich traditions associated with them. Whether used in the classroom or for fun at home, these pages provide a fantastic way for students to explore art and culture.
